Transaction 95d72f63b7edd8a88fba82f9d3640151348a880445684c8ec24babfa1f00202e
2 Input
2 Outputs
- 95d72f63b7edd8a88fba82f9d3640151348a880445684c8ec24babfa1f00202e:0
- 95d72f63b7edd8a88fba82f9d3640151348a880445684c8ec24babfa1f00202e:1
value 1005228
address 11GNNaDLTHdqhhaAvgaLkqFnhorSdhNUh
value 570819
address 19oa6gqYkhXmdu7hYk8y45Zsus9eXfvsfE